Most people open Claude, type something vague, get something disappointing, and quietly
conclude the tool is overrated. That person is who this series was written for.
Nine short books, one idea each. What Claude actually is and what it costs. The four
parts of a request that lands. The six steering moves that fix almost any answer in
eleven words. How to hand over documents, images and spreadsheets — and what Claude
genuinely *sees* inside each. Artifacts you keep, projects that stop you re-explaining
yourself, and a clear-eyed book on catching a fluent, confident, completely wrong answer
before you act on it.
It follows one small studio through a year of getting good at this, because ordinary
work — reports, emails, a difficult client — is more useful than abstract advice.
Every model name, price, limit and feature was checked against Anthropic's own published
documentation, and every calculation in a worked example was computed rather than
estimated. A guide that teaches last year's prices is worse than no guide.
